Scald 1 cup All-Bran in boiling water; add raisins (if desired).
Add this to sugar, 2 cups All-Bran, shortening, eggs, flour and salt in a large bowl.
Mix in other bowl, buttermilk and soda; mix well.
Add to other ingredients.
Add raisins and bran; beat this well but only by hand.
Put in airtight container.
Put in refrigerator.
Don't stir again.
When you want muffins, use cupcake baking shells.
Fill 2/3 full.
Bake at 400\u00b0 for 25 minutes.
Return remaining batter to refrigerator until needed.

Heat oven to 325\u00b0.
Melt cheese and 1/2 stick margarine in 9 x 13-inch casserole dish.
Stir in Veg-All.
In another container, mix 1/2 stick margarine and 1 stack crushed Ritz crackers.
Add crumbs on top of Veg-All mixture.
Bake until bubbly, about 15 to 20 minutes.

Preheat oven to 425 degrees F (220 degrees C).
Spread oil in the bottom of a 9 inch square baking dish. Sift flour into a medium bowl, then beat in eggs. Gradually stir in milk, water, salt and pepper. Beat well.
Place sausages in baking dish and pour batter mixture over all. Bake in the preheated oven for 25 to 30 minutes, or until golden and risen.

Combine all ingredients in a bowl & mix by hand for 10min or until u have a workable dough.
Let dough rise in a warm bowl until it has doubled in size, about 1hr.
Form 3-4oz rolls and place on GREASED cookie sheets.
Let double in size again. Bake at 400 degrees for about 25mins., or until rolls are lightly browned.
Remove from oven and brush with melted butter.
